The very same happens on my device (Sony Xperia XZ3, Android 12, LineageOS 18.1, FossifyOrg Phone 1.2.0). It's quite annoying IMO, since this way the app hides part of information one could be interested in reading.
It goes the same when you choose "show call details" on the right side of a not-too-short phonebook name (in the call history): in portrait mode, most of the number of that specific entry remains hidden, with no way to scroll to see the missing part.
The only workaround is to put the smartphone in landscape mode.
If you implemented autoscrolling, or enabled a manual scroll of long rows, it would do the trick. Please think about it for future releases.
